Extruded aluminum fins are basically ridges that run alongside the case and significantly improve the cooling. They can be tall or short and simple or elaborate in profile. The great things about them is they look high tech, greatly improve heat exchange, and are much cheaper to manufacture (basically molten aluminum is squeezed through this profile as it solidified, and then appropriate length pieces are cut up. We use the term power variability. An explaination of that term is below, and excerpted form our online glossary of terms.

Power Variability: The number of individual settings available on a studio flash. A flash that has 6 individual stops of adjustment (1/1, 1/2, 1/4, 1/8, 1/16, 1/32) has a 6 stop power variability and a 5 stop range, or 5 incremental settings away from the starting point (1/1, or full power). Some flash manufacturers incorrectly use the term “range” to indicate the number of individual settings on a given flash, i.e. the same flash with 6 stops of power variability would be advertised as having a “6 stop range”. Since they are including the starting point, this is incorrect. We use the term “power variability” to correctly state the number of full stop settings available on our flashes.

I hate this situation. We have always specified our lights correctly . . . Full to 1/32 power = 5 f stop range. Competitors started calling this 6 f range because you can shoot at one of six full f stop settings (including 0).

I have argued this point to tears on various forums and compared it with calling a 12" ruler a 13" ruler. Nobody cared and I was called bad names and egotistical for trying to correct the misstatements.

At this point, about half the manufacturers use the incorrect method so we reluctantly decided to adopt the new "standard" after tiring of seeing comments "Gee XXX light has more range than AB" even though they are the same.

We always qualify the range by stating the Max/Min power range (1:32 on AB, 1:256 on Einstein). B&H has introduced the term "Flash Variability" to dodge the dictionary definition of "Range". It's all marketing hype. I believe Elinchrom started this one and was followed by others.
